物联网方向)专业毕业论文(设计) 5 1. 串口信号 RX(0 号)、 TX(1 号) : 与内部 ATmega8U2 USB-to-TTL 芯片相连,提供 TTL 电压水平的串口接收信号。 2. 外部中断( 2 号和 3 号):触发中断引脚,可设成上升沿、下降沿或同时触发。 3. 脉冲宽度调制 PWM (3、5、6、9、 10、 11 ):提供 6路8位 PWM 输出。 4. SPI ( 10(SS) , 11(MOSI) , 12(MISO) , 13(SCK) ): SPI 通信接口。 5. LED ( 13号): Arduino 专门用于测试 LED 的保留接口, 输出为高时点亮 LED , 反之输出为低时 LED 熄灭。 2. 6 路模拟输入 A0到 A5 :每一路具有 10 位的分辨率(即输入有 1024 个不同值),默认输入信号范围为 0到 5V ,可以通过 AREF 调整输入上限。除此之外,有些引脚有特定功能 TWI 接口( SDA A4和 SCL A5 ):支持通信接口(兼容 I2C 总线)。 1. AREF :模拟输入信号的参考电压。 2. Reset :信号为低时复位单片机芯片。通信接口 1. 串口: ATmega328 内置的 UART 可以通过数字口 0( RX )和 1( TX )与外部实现串口通信; ATmega16U2 可以访问数字口实现 USB 上的虚拟串口。 2. TWI (兼容 I2C )接口: 3. SPI 接口: Arduino 和 wifi 组合做成的网关, 一方面通过 wifi 模块连接网络与服务器通信, 负责收发数据、数据简单处理和中转数据。通过 ssh 的连接进行数据处理,通过 uno 板对步进电机的自动控制。 Aduin o 和 wifi 模块实物如图 2-1 所示。陶嫣琳:基于 arduino 的晾衣架设备和系统开发 6